Originally released in 2015. Behind Bayonets and Barbed Wire is a documentary film. directed by Richard L. Anderson. With a runtime of 2h 6m, it's an epic theatrical experience.

Synopsis

The story of American POWs, who were surrendered in the Philippines to the Japanese Army, then sent to slave labor camps in the northern Chinese city of Mukden (now Shenyang).
